This is parallel information about communication styles. I looked it up on the other site.
Dhyana, reported on the findings of researcher Helen Fisher. According to Fisher the 4
main types of temperament have a specific chemical or neurotransmitters that dominate.
NF estrogen dominates the negotiator type temperament
NT testosterone dominates the director type temperament
SJ serotonin dominates the builder type temperament
SP dopamine dominates the explorer type temperament
